DESCRIPTION:Description:\nFor tackling engineering tasks with advanced AI c
	apabilities\, one can use multi-agent systems that orchestrate specialized
	 tools. These tools encapsulate large parts of the underlying engineering 
	knowledge. Due to the generally complex nature of engineering tasks\, the 
	respective multi-agent systems oftentimes require additional care regardin
	g their robustness. In this talk\, Dr. Marc Eric Vogt\, Heinrich Schmidt\,
	 and Dr. Thomas Hugle show how they achieve this necessary robustness by u
	sing a state-based multi-agent system and deterministic logic in key locat
	ions. While they focus on the engineering case\, the general lessons learn
	ed should apply to all multi-agent systems that tackle complex problems wi
	th a large number of underlying variables.\n------------------------------
